Low Carb Cheese Crackers
Recipe By : adapted from George Stella
Serving Size : 4 Preparation Time :0:00
Categories : Snacks
Amount Measure Ingredient -- Preparation Method
-------- ------------ --------------------------------
2 slices American cheese -- from Deli counter
2 oz Colby-Jack cheese -- deli-sliced
1/2 ts salt
1/4 ts chili powder
1/4 ts garlic powder
Make sure that the American Cheese you buy is NOT "cheese food" but real cheese bought at the deli counter. Not the packaged kind in the dairy aisle.
Preheat oven to 400 degrees F. Line 2 rimmed cookie sheets with parchment paper OR a Silpat liner.
Stack the slices of American Cheese and cut it into 16 small squares. Separate the pieces and transfer them to a small bowl. Combine seasonings and add them to the cheese. Shake around and coat well.
Place on one of the prepared sheet pans, 4 rows of 8 pieces of cheese.
Stack the Colby cheese slices and cut them into 24 small pieces and arrange them on the other prepared pan - 4 rows of 6.
Bake both sheet pans until well-browned and crispy, about 7 to 7-1/2 minutes. If undercooked, they'll be soggy so don't be afraid to check them and put them back in the oven if they need more time.
Cool the crackers completely before storing them. Store on the counter in an airtight container at room temperature for a few days.*

NOTES : Risa's notes:
* If they are underbaked, they will be soggy when stored so make sure they are completely crisp and cool before storing. If they are a bit soggy, then refrigerate them. When you want to eat them, remove from refrigerator about 1/2 hour before snacking. Then snack away!
